Where is the sea the sea set?

London
A novel set on the northern English coast and in London circa the 1970s; published in 1978. A famous theatrical director retires to a remote house on the English coast where he writes his memoirs and is confronted by his personal demons.

Which types of books are based on true stories?

From time to time, historical fiction authors incorporate real-life people and stories into their works, extending the genre beyond just fiction set in the past. Other writers base their books around a true news story or mystery, lending their imagination to a nonfiction event.

Why is the sea the sea?

According to Peter J. Conradi in his biography of Murdoch, the title of her Booker Prize-winning novel The Sea, The Sea (1978) comes from “the Greeks’ cry during the Persian wars when they finally sight salt-water” (i.e. the Black Sea) as reported in Xenophon’s Anabasis.

What was JK Rowling’s favorite book?

Emma
“Emma” by Jane Austen Jane Austen is J.K. Rowling’s favorite author of all time, and “Emma” is her favorite of her books. “I’ve read all her books so many times I’ve lost count,” she told Amazon. Of those many book-reading sessions, she said she read “Emma” at least 20 times.
